The Full-Time Server role at Resort Lifestyle Communities is an opportunity to contribute to a warm, engaging dining experience for senior residents. This position goes beyond serving meals; it is about creating joyful, meaningful moments every day. As part of a collaborative and servant-hearted team, the server plays an essential role in enhancing the quality of life for residents by offering attentive, compassionate service throughout breakfast and lunch hours. The position is full-time with work hours primarily from Monday to Friday, 7:30 am to 2:00 pm, with some required flexibility for evenings, weekends, and holidays.

In this role, you will be the friendly face that residents see at the start of their day, setting a positive tone through personalized attention, thoughtful communication, and response to individual needs. Responsibilities include greeting residents, carrying trays, serving drinks and meals, explaining menu options, and anticipating needs to ensure an exceptional dining experience. Maintaining a clean and inviting dining environment is also a key aspect, involving clearing and resetting tables, cleaning the salad bar, vacuuming carpets, and other housekeeping duties that support a seamless service operation.

The server is also responsible for delivering room service meals with a positive attitude and ensuring timely tray pickups. Listening and responding with kindness to any resident feedback is an important part of maintaining the community’s caring atmosphere. The role requires a willingness to jump in and assist with other support tasks assigned by supervisors to foster a cooperative and efficient team environment.
